Do you know the Different Sizes of Dumpsters Accessible?

Determined by the size of your project, you may require a little or large dumpster that could hold all of the debris and leftover materials.

Dumpster rental firms typically supply several sizes for individuals and businesses. Deciding on the best size should enable you to remove debris as affordably as possible.

The most common dumpsters include 10-yard, 20-yard, 30-yard, and 40-yard models. When you are in possession of a little project, including clearing out a garage or cellar, you can likely reap the benefits of a 10-yard or 20-yard dumpster. When you have a larger project, including an entire remodel or building a brand new house, then you'll likely need a 30-yard or 40-yard dumpster.

Lots of people choose to rent a larger dumpster than they think they'll need. Although renting a larger dumpster prices more cash, it's more affordable than having to an additional dumpster after a little one gets full.


What's the largest size dumpster accessible?

The largest roll-off dumpster that companies usually rent is a 40 yard container. This gigantic d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is equal to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.

The weight limitation on 40 yard containers usually 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be quite mindful of the limitation and do your best not to exceed it. Should you go over the limit, you can incur overage charges, which add up quickly.

Examples of projects that a 40 yard container will be the perfect size for include: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-dwelling interior renovation Getting rid of rubbish when you are moving in or out House demolition New house construction Commercial and residential cleanouts

Roll Off Dumpster vs. Dumpster Tote

Dumpster totes may offer an option to roll of dumpsters. Whether this alternative works well for you, however, will depend on your own job. Consider these pros and cons before you decide on a disposal alternative that works for you.

Roll Off Dumpsters

It is difficult to beat a roll off dumpster when you have a big job that'll create plenty of debris. Most rental companies comprise dropping off and picking up the dumpster in the costs, so you can avoid additional fees. Roll off dumpsters generally have time constraints because firms need to get them back for other customers. This is a potential drawback if you're not great at meeting deadlines.

Dumpster Bags

Dumpster totes are often convenient for small jobs with loose deadlines. If you do not want lots of room for debris, then the bags could function nicely for you. Many companies are also happy to allow you to maintain the totes for so long as you need. That makes them useful for longer projects.


What Size Dumpster Do I Want for a Roofing Project?

Choosing a dumpster size necessitates some educated guesswork. It is often difficult for individuals to estimate the sizes that they need for roofing jobs because, practically, they have no idea how much material their roofs contain.

There are, however, some basic guidelines you can follow to make the ideal choice. If you are removing a commercial roof, then you will most likely require a dumpster that offers you at least 40 square yards.

If you are working on residential roofing project, then you can generally rely on a smaller size. You can generally exp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will likely desire a 20-yard dumpster.

Many folks order one size larger than they believe their jobs will take because they want to stay away from the additional exp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ters which weren't large enough.

What is the lowest size dumpster accessible?

The lowest size roll off dumpster commonly accessible is 10 yards. This container will hold about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is approximately equal to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is an excellent choice for small jobs, such as modest house cleanouts.

Other examples of jobs that a 10 yard container would function well for include: A garage, shed or attic c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A little kitchen or bathroom remodeling job Concrete or dirt removal Getting rid of junk Take note that weight restrictions for the containers are enforced, thus exceeding the weight limit will incur additional costs. The normal weight limit for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).

A 10 yard bin can help you take care of small jobs round the house. If you have a bigger job coming up, have a look at some bigger containers also.


40 yard dumpster measurements

Renting a 40 yard dumpster can get you a container that holds about 40 cubic yards of waste. Dumpster sizes and dimensions aren't totally normal from company to company, but common measurements for a 40 yard container are 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 8 feet high. This is the biggest size that a lot of dumpster firms commonly rent, therefore it is perfect for big residential projects as well as for commercial and industrial use.

A 40 yard container will carry between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ris. Examples of the amount of waste and debris that could fit in this container contain:

  • Waste from a window or siding replacement for a large dwelling
  • A commercial roof tear off A cleanout from a commercial or office building
  • New construction or a major add-on to a large dwelling
  • Sizeable amounts of demolition debris, paper, cardboard and junk

How Long Can I Rent a Dumpster For?

The total amount of time that you will need to rent a dumpster in Disney normally depends on the type of job you're working on. A little endeavor, including a basement clean out, will likely take a number of days to finish while bigger projects, like building a new house, could take several months.

Most trash dumpsters rentals companies in Disney are happy to adjust their programs to fit your needs. Keep in your mind, however, that the the more time you keep the dumpster, the further you will have to pay for it.

When you contact trash dumpsters rentals companies in Disney, ask them how long their terms are. Many will allow you choices such as several days or one week, but there are typically longer durations available, too.

You also ought to inquire how much the companies charge for extra time. That way, you know how much it costs to keep the dumpster for a couple extra days if desired.
